Change your ends on the hyd. cyl. They do go bad and this will cause this to happen . Went thru this this spring on the disk and corn planter . It would raise it but if you went to drop it it would start down and just stop then you would have to raise it up and try to let it down slowly if you went to fast it would lock up again . Last year it was the plow that was doing the same thing And like Allen said tighten up the drag on the draft control lever it is and easy fix , But the adjusting bolt MAY be rusted tight and THEY will break off and then that is a real pain in the donkey . Myself i like to remove the bolt and clean out the threads with a tap and install a new bolt with never seeze on it for ease of later adjustments.
